Skip to content

Instantly share code, notes, and snippets.

@leberblock
Created September 4, 2012 11:46
Show Gist options
  • Save leberblock/3620525 to your computer and use it in GitHub Desktop.
Save leberblock/3620525 to your computer and use it in GitHub Desktop.
log4j: create appender which logs in separate logfile
### 1. create appender
<appender name="JpaLogFile" class="org.apache.log4j.FileAppender">
<param name="File" value="/tomcat/logs/JpaTransactionManagerDebug.log" />
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d{ISO8601} %-5p %c [executionDate=%X{executionDate}]- %m%n" />
</layout>
</appender>
### 2. configure logger
<logger name="org.springframework.orm.jpa.JpaTransactionManager" additivity="false">
<level value="DEBUG"/>
<appender-ref ref="JpaLogFile"/>
</logger>
### 3. init appender in root-section
<appender-ref ref="JpaLogFile"/>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ment